Your wealth can be increased by having more than one opponent call.When you are playing multiple tables simultaneously, one thing you need to remember is that it may be difficult to focus on the play at any given table. Your attention may be split between all your hands. This can negatively impact your ability and quality of play. To get used to playing online, it is best to play at one table first. Then you can move on to a second table. It is not difficult for you to play at two or three tables.
